Output 5218899643e6eaefee03eee82f76e23e802943e0210f5c1409f8ce4fd0898f89:1

value
621000
script pubkey
OP_0 OP_PUSHBYTES_20 16a26b29b94fa66bfced5d26dd086f6d1037487e
address
bc1qz63xk2def7nxhl8dt5nd6zr0d5grwjr7a2pzu4
transaction
5218899643e6eaefee03eee82f76e23e802943e0210f5c1409f8ce4fd0898f89
spent
true